**Alert: FeedProof validator failures**

The FeedProof service began rejecting roughly 12% of podcast feeds overnight due to a stricter enclosure-length check rolled out in the last deploy. Affected publishers see a generic validation error with no remediation hint. A rollback flag exists but has not been exercised in production. For the weekly eng sync: we need a decision on rollback versus a softened warning mode. Repro cases and logs are collected; requests for the triage bundle should be sent to the feeds duty rotation.

escalation mailbox, fafof-bahip: tamael@ordincorp.test

Handover — Penrose dedupe service (for plugin authors)

Taking over from Ilya. Matching pipeline is stable; fuzzy-name pass runs nightly, exact-key pass runs on ingest. Plugins must declare merge priority or records silently win by recency — known footgun, fix pending. Don't touch the phonetic matcher thresholds without rerunning the Calverton benchmark set. Current service configuration your plugin should assume is as follows.

service settings:
PRAIX_LOG_LEVEL=error
PRAIX_METRICS_HOST=metrics.praix.qorvelcorp.corp
PRAIX_POOL_SIZE=16

**ALERT: export-timezone-drift** — The Fernwick reporting service is generating exports where timestamps shift by the viewer's local offset instead of the account's configured timezone. Affects CSV and PDF exports queued through the Lanternjob worker since the 3.8 release. Scheduled exports are correct; only on-demand exports drift. A fix is staged behind the `tz-pin` flag. Reviewers should block changes touching export serialization until the fix merges. Report new occurrences to the reporting on-call.

escalation mailbox, hadug-bajog: sormir@norvalabs.internal

Handover for the Crashbin pipeline. It ingests crash reports from the Petrel mobile app, batches them, and ships summaries to triage. Watch the queue depth; anything over 10k means the parser is stuck. Restarting the worker usually fixes it. Talk to Dara for access. Current production config follows.

config for hahif-yahop:
[istox]
port = 9000
region = central-3
host = istox.zarqelnet.test
team = noviel
timeout_ms = 500
retries = 5